Position Summary:

We are seeking a skilled and dependable Streets Maintenance Worker to support the ongoing maintenance and improvement of the City's roadway infrastructure. This role is responsible for performing a wide range of hands-on work including street and sidewalk repair, signage installation, and pavement marking. The ideal candidate brings practical experience, strong problem-solving abilities, and a commitment to delivering high-quality work that keeps our community safe and running smoothly.

Normal Shift: 7:00 a.m. to 3:30 p.m.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Street and Sidewalk Maintenance: Engage in general labor tasks including asphalt paving, concrete repair, joint and crack sealing, street sign fabrication and installation, and pavement marking.
  • Traffic Control: Set up and manage work zones and roadway traffic control to ensure safety and compliance.
  • Equipment Operation: Operate and perform minor maintenance on light and heavy equipment, power tools, and motorized equipment. Operate vehicles up to and including Class "B" CDL size with air brakes.
  • Snow Removal: Participate in snow removal activities to keep streets and public areas accessible and safe.

Minimum Requirements:

  • Must be a U.S. citizen or lawfully authorized alien worker.
  • High School graduate or GED certificate.
  • One (1) year of applicable experience.
  • Must have a Class "B" CDL valid in the state of Missouri or obtain within 120 days of employment. Commercial drivers' instruction permit (CDIP) must be obtained within 60 days of employment.
  • Ability to frequently lift and/or move up to 50 lbs. and occasionally lift and/or move more than 90 lbs.

Compensation & Benefits:

  • Competitive Salary: Market-based pay structure with step placement determined by qualifications and experience
  • Retirement & Financial security: Missouri LAGERS L-6 defined benefit pension plan (with Rule of 80), 457 deferred compensation plan, Roth retirement savings option, and retiree health coverage
  • Leave & Holiday benefits: Vacation (up to 6 weeks), sick leave, 12 paid holidays and 1 personal day
  • Health & Wellness: Medical, dental and vision coverage options; City-paid Life and AD&D insurance ($50,000); long-term disability; voluntary supplemental insurance options, Employee Assistance Program (EAP), and Preventative Care Time Off
  • Flexible Spending Accounts (FSA): medical and dependent care options
  • Education Support: Tuition reimbursement (up to 6-8 classes per year)
